forked from ~ljy/RK356X_SDK_RELEASE

hc
2024-10-22 8ac6c7a54ed1b98d142dce24b11c6de6a1e239a5
kernel/drivers/net/wireless/intel/iwlwifi/fw/debugfs.c
....@@ -344,8 +344,10 @@
344344 const struct iwl_fw *fw = priv->fwrt->fw;
345345
346346 *pos = ++state->pos;
347
- if (*pos >= fw->ucode_capa.n_cmd_versions)
347
+ if (*pos >= fw->ucode_capa.n_cmd_versions) {
348
+ kfree(state);
348349 return NULL;
350
+ }
349351
350352 return state;
351353 }